IP查询
查询
你查询的IP:[121.58.85.161] 地理位置:中国–海南
最新查询
221.45.168.139
58.30.2.83
117.128.238.130
125.64.223.225
117.44.105.1
121.89.58.118
123.184.103.193
203.192.80.170
221.13.225.218
121.58.85.161
119.75.208.67
210.32.241.131
203.99.16.130
124.147.128.141
121.224.124.19
203.148.184.166
119.28.151.142
123.206.222.185
202.38.150.204
120.76.248.248
125.210.118.28
125.96.254.58
202.91.164.255
117.53.176.228
119.20.196.118
211.96.97.32
118.102.16.15
119.57.101.65
203.99.80.18
117.32.141.20
202.122.128.174